INTERNATIONAL AUTO S. & S., INC. v. GENERAL TRUCK DRIV., ETC.

Civ. A. No. 68-2030.

311 F.Supp. 313 (1970)

INTERNATIONAL AUTO SALES & SERVICE, INC., Plaintiff, v. GENERAL TRUCK DRIVERS, CHAUFFEURS, WAREHOUSEMEN & HELPERS, LOCAL UNION NO. 270, Affiliated With the International Brothererhood of Teamsters, Chauffeurs, Warehousemen & Helpers of America, Defendant.

United States District Court, E. D. Louisiana, New Orleans Division.

February 25, 1970.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Michael J. Molony, Jr., Edmund C. Salassi, Robert K. McCalla, Jones, Walker, Waechter, Poitevent, Carrere & Denegre, New Orleans, La., for plaintiff.

John W. Ormond, Nelson, Ormond & Nelson, New Orleans, La., for defendant.


CASSIBRY, District Judge.

Plaintiff employer sues to vacate and set aside an arbitration award which required reinstatement with back pay of an employee who the defendant Union claimed was discharged without cause. Plaintiff does not question the defendant's contractual right to have the employee's discharge arbitrated, but complains that the arbitrator's award exceeded his authority under the contract.
